Truck Explodes at Temple in Tunisia
A natural gas tanker truck crashed into the outer wall of a synagogue on a Tunisian resort island Thursday, causing an explosion that killed five people and injured dozens.
Although Europe has seen a spate of anti-Semitic attacks recently, the government called the explosion on the island of Djerba an accident, and the synagogue’s president agreed.
Among the dead were two German tourists, according to a hospital list obtained from Gov. Mohammed ben Salem. The other fatalities were two synagogue workers and the driver of the truck, all identified as Tunisian.
